How many solutions can be found for the equation −4x − 11 = 2(x − 3x) + 13?

None
One
Two
Infinitely many

Answer:

None

Step-by-step explanation:

-4x-11=2(x-3x)+13

-4x-11=2x-6x+13

-4x-11=-4x+13

-11=13

Therefore, there are no solutions for the equation as both sides will never be equal to each other.
